Academic thesis multidisciplinary as part of the Creation in Small and Medium-sized Entreprises (CPME). Project consisting by the study of commercialization of an innovative solution to detect cancerous cells inside samples destined to a cell therapy's use. Our tests are currently being developed inside the laboratory of Celyad by the biologist of our group. Cell Therapy consist of removing stem cells by the sick patient, in order to make them specialized of the organ. Once programmed, these cells are being injected in the patient, and regenerate the hurt tissue. The problem is that during this culture's process, appearance of cancerous cells may occurs. That's why we must detect their presence or not. The only recognized method is actually the karyotype, which is long, costly and doesn't get the agreement of all the scientific community. Therefore, to find a reliable alternative seems to be compulsory to insure patient's security. Scancell provides three new tests to detect the flawed samples.
